Here's how I made the take-out box....

I printed the template for the takeout box over 2 sheets of A4 paper and cut and stuck them together- as pictured. Then I traced the whole shape onto textured card and scored all the fold lines.

Next, very simply I folded up the box and attached the wire handle (there is no glue sticking this box together at all!) and embellished with some Easter eggs made from an oval punch. Finally, I filled with chocolate goodies and a cute little birdie.
